Transaction 3508778b378e76ed00839b85dc36b712a6463bde6db793bae752b247476dcd26

27 Input
2 Outputs
  • 3508778b378e76ed00839b85dc36b712a6463bde6db793bae752b247476dcd26:0
  • value  1000030
    address  1FDqhyuZ1sshWLfoNoLZeZX7ndyX5rJ8JF
  • 3508778b378e76ed00839b85dc36b712a6463bde6db793bae752b247476dcd26:1
  • value  4864089
    address  31udJ53goTqmHnfUNfSLSE2VGEbZGGgsew